I won't bother showing you the before pics because I'm sure you guys have seen a stock exhaust system before :)

I had a local muffler shop install a fabbed cat back system with dual pipes. The left pipe was a pain in the ass for the guy to bend. He put on a Flowmaster 50 Delta Series Dual in/out muffler and welded a pair of oval SS tips. I'm really happy with the results!

Pipes Bent Bad

I'm just wondering if the bend on that left pipe is to bent for a good exhaust flow. I mean borla makes a big fuss about manderal bends so it must make a difference right? I ask this because i wanted a dual setup on my 97 explorer sport but the guy said that the pipes would be bent all weird and restrict the flow. So i went with the 2.5 inch in/out 2 chamber 40 series and it rumbles for a V6.
 












You can run dual exhaust with a V8 or V6. I have the V6 and installed a Dual out muffler with dual pipes. They were able to bend it around the spare tire with no cutting. Also, the low restrictiveness (spelling) of the high performance muffler more than compensates for the bends in the second pipe.

Go for it, it adds a nice look.
 






I had the same problem trying to get true dual exhaust. My muffler shop said that there wasn't enough room to put in a dual exhaust with a full size spare tire in my '98 5.0 XLT
 






My friedn that works at the muffler shop also told me I couldn't run true duals without getting rid of the spare. So i left ti stock with just a dynomax 2in 1out muffler. Plus I decided I didn't want to lose alot of torque anyway.
 






I don't run "true duals" cos theres nowhere to mount the 2nd muffler, but anyone who tells you you can't run duals w/o removing the spare doesn't know what they're talking about, I ran a dual in/out flow 50, but I've seen some people run 2 glasspack lookin ones side by side in the stock location.. its possible
 






I even looked and couldn't see where to run the second pipe. We didn't want to run the second one on the other side of the spare because it would be too close to the gas tank. If anyone has any pics of true duals with the spare then I would like to see them so I can get ideas.
